qçìÅÜ=pÅêÉÉå=`~äáÄê~íáçå

As an excellent prerequisite to all operating procedures, it is recommended that you calibrate the Touch Screen.

„Use the following steps to calibrate your Touch Screen display:

1.If required, press {HOME} to display the Home Menu.

2.Press {DISPLAY} to show the Display Settings Menu.

3.Press {LCD CAL} to display the first Touch Screen Calibration Menu.

4.Follow directions on screen to complete the calibration procedure.

On rare occasion, you can experience LOS (loss of signal) — typically due to a poor video or computer connection. In these cases, PresentationPRO-II obeys a precise set of rules:

Scaler LOS — If there is a LOS for a video signal inside a scaler (PIP or KEY), the video switches to black, but the scaler remains in its current size and position.

Background LOS — If there is a LOS for the background DVI input, the video switches to the background’s selected matte color.

DSK LOS — If there is a LOS for the DSK, the system switches the DSK Off (specifically, selecting "none" as the type).

In each case, when the video signal recovers, the system re-enables it as before.
